Exploring usability issues of e-government websites in Bangladesh and their impact on users with limited digital literacy

Abstract

While Bangladesh is advancing with its “Digital Bangladesh” initiative, the success of e-government platforms in transforming public service delivery greatly relies on how such platforms are accessible and usable by all citizens, ranging from novice to proficient in digital skills. However, significant usability challenges for users with limited digital literacy create a digital divide that undermines the inclusivity and effectiveness of these platforms. This research explores the various usability challenges faced by users with limited digital proficiency, revealing the underlying factors contributing to these challenges and finally proposing solutions to promote inclusivity and bridge the digital divide. By incorporating a mixed-method approach like questionnaires, interviews, and heuristic evaluation, it seeks a deeper understanding of user experiences on those platforms. Data collection involved 293 survey respondents, 9 administrative interviews, and 19 mediator interviews. Through comprehensive data analysis, the study discovers a range of infrastructural and organizational challenges faced by users across the four selected e-service platforms. Notably, the analysis also unveils the underlying reasons for the prevalence of mediators, which emerged as a critical aspect of users’ coping mechanisms against the challenges. It reveals that high dependency on mediators stems from limited digital literacy, navigation struggles, infrastructural barriers, and user impatience. These findings put additional emphasis on user-centric design enhancements to mitigate these challenges. Thus, this study draws from global best practices to offer practical design solutions that enhance user experience and digital inclusion in Bangladesh’s e-government services.
